In Absolutely Essential, Jonathan Moreno explores the field of bioethics as both a creature and a key element of the post–World War II rules-based order. According to this order, international relations are to be organized according to principles of open markets, liberal democracy, and multilateral organizations.

Drawing on the author’s four decades of experience in the field, the book raises key questions about the future of bioethics in a changed world order, while also theorizing new ways to think about bioethics after the COVID-19 pandemic and the reordering of global alliances. For bioethicists, this book will contextualize the field in an entirely new light, while readers unfamiliar with bioethics will appreciate that this seemingly esoteric field is in fact a paradigmatic creation of the global system now undergoing sweeping change.

An Insightful Historical Review of the Evolution of Global Bioethics

This is an excellent review of the historical development of bioethics across the world, demonstrating how the efficacy of the current regime is predicated on a somewhat nebulous "rules-based international order" (i.e. rich nominally democratic nations setting and enforcing rules). This is useful because too often ethical frameworks have a purely domestic bent, which given the global nature of science and industry is divorced from the reality of how these fields operate. Moreno shows how the international community has consistently built norms over time backed by state power (e.g. Nuremberg code, recent CRISPR scandals, etc.), and starts to probe what the current reshuffling of global power structures means for bioethical practice. As inarguably the most advanced technical ethical field, books like this are ones that the business and tech community should read closely to understand how to begin to build a comparable depth of organizations and practices.
